Job description

Job title: Plant Maintenance Technician

Location: Dover

Salary: up to £42,000 + additional overtime, call out and standby payments

Hours: Monday to Friday, 7.30am - 4.00pm

The role:

This is a hands-on role where you'll play a key part in ensuring our clients assets are maintained, repaired and operating safely and efficiently. You will be maintaining HGV, mobile and harbour cranes, forklift trucks, telehandlers, vehicles and other mobile plant and equipment.

Working Environment:
  • Working in varied conditions including noise, weather exposure and heavy-duty environments
  • Required to work additional hours, including overtime and emergency callouts
  • Participate in a standby rota (approx. 1 week in every 8 weeks)
